Finance Review Summary — Brellan Foods Franchise Agreement

The board reviewed the proposed ten-year franchise agreement with Orvic Hospitality covering the Marleton corridor. Royalty terms remain at four percent, with capital contributions capped and audited annually. Counsel flagged no material exposure. We recommend conditional approval pending the Q3 cash review. The note below sets out the confidential expansion rationale.

management briefing: Casvanek Logistics plans to lower the Druox list price by 49.1 percent in April. The board signed off on a budget of $16.5 million for Project Rusath. The renewal with Kasvanix Partners closes at $67.9 million a year, 33.9 percent above the last contract. Project Casath slips by one quarter because of the staffing delay.

Subject: Marketing Budget Adjustment — Q4

Team,

Following last week's review, the marketing budget for Q4 will be reduced by roughly eighteen percent. The Lanterbrook campaign and the Ferris Point sponsorship are paused; digital spend for the Corvette Analytics launch continues unchanged. Department heads should submit revised spend plans by Friday. No headcount changes are tied to this decision. Questions go to Delia in planning. The rationale connects to a broader shift in strategy, summarised in the confidential note below.

management briefing: Project Ulavan slips by two quarters because of the staffing delay.

# Break-Glass: Catalog Cache Invalidation

Scope: the Pinrow product catalog at Veldstone Retail. If stale prices persist after a purge and the Hollowmere invalidation queue is wedged, use break-glass to flush the edge tier directly. Contractors: get verbal sign-off from the catalog lead first. Steps: open the Hollowmere admin shell, select emergency-flush, confirm the tenant, and run it once — repeated flushes thrash the origin. Access is logged and expires after 20 minutes. Unseal the admin shell with the passphrase below.

recovery phrase for kahop-tajog: istix-casvan

14:22 — Discovered the Wrenfold build was fetching display fonts from the retired Glyphhaven CDN at compile time. Vendored all four font families into the assets repo, pinned checksums, and removed the network fetch step. Builds are now fully offline-reproducible. Future maintainers: update vendored fonts only via the script in tools/fonts. Verification token below.

build token for kagaf-hahof: htk14_9d3d4d26d7d8de